Sarah read the Bronze Bow, which is a coming of age story set in the time of Jesus. It won the Newbery award in the early sixties.

Abby is reading the Maisie Dobbs books, which are mysteries set in England after WWI.

Sarah made a chickpea soup, which is light enough to be enjoyed in the summer. Recipe for the soup below:

  • 2 cans of chickpeas (or one cup cooked in the Instant Pot)
  • 1 can coconut milk
  • 1 cup vegetable broth
  •  1/2 cup salsa
  • 1 1/2 tsp garam masala
  • 1 tsp ginger
  • 2 Tbsp apple juice concentrate (I never add this as I never have it)
  • 1/4 cup of cilantro (I usually do half a bunch)

Add ingredients to a blender or use immersion blender until pureed. Heat. Serve!
